Our Story
SNOW WHITE & ROSE RED / A TALE OF TWO SISTERS
Long before Briarbook Lane became a website, it began as a dream between sisters.
As teenagers, Mary and Elizabeth imagined someday living beside one another, with library-filled homes connected by a shared garden path—a place to gather stories, creativity, and quiet magic.
Life took us different directions, but the dream never fully disappeared.
In 2020, Briarbook Lane became our way of bringing that dream to life online: a shared creative home for books, writing, fairy tales, and the worlds we love.

📚 Briarbook Lane Press
In 2021, we founded Briarbook Lane Press to independently publish stories and poetry created under the Briarbook Lane name. Today, the press publishes Mary W. Jensen’s fantasy and poetry works, with more stories still to come.
